  4. How about "Dante lite" = Oumar Ballo from AZ:  7-feet and 260 pounds makes him a difficult player for opponents to manage. He averaged 12.9 points and 10.1 rebounds in 2023-24 for Arizona on 65.8% shooting. There isn't much versatility to his game, and Ballo's free-throw shooting dipped to a career-worst 49.5% this past season. But he's a productive bruiser with a proven track record at an elite program.

  6. A little historical note:

     

    That floor kept Dana's 20 game win streak going, plus never having had a losing season at Oregon.

     

    As you may recall, in Dana's first season we literally bought our way into the CBI with a 16 - 17 record.

     

    After 3 wins and a loss, the last 2 games were at the Matt.

     

    In the Championship game a Creighton player had an over-and-back violation late in the game that lead to a 71-69 win.  The floor was later changed to have a more distinctive mid-court line.
